A.1.1
Force
Fundamentals
The function Force permits the manipulation of signal states independently of actual operating condi­
tions. Force enables input and output signals to be overwritten. Input signals actually present or
changes in status by the program will be ignored. The input signals actually present and the output
signals generated by the user program only become valid again when the Force function is deactivated.
Warning
Uncontrolled movements of the machine and the system resulting from manipulation of
signal states.
Injury to people, damage to the machine and system
• Observe notes regarding the "Force" function in the "CPX system description"
(è Tab. 1).
The "Force" function is used mainly in the commissioning phase in order to set certain signals to the
desired status for test purposes even if the wiring is not complete.
